Cursive Opley 6 is a very light, very narrow, medium contrast, italic, very short x-height font.

A delicate, slanted script built from thin, pen-like strokes with lightly tapered terminals and a smooth, continuous rhythm. Letters are tall and narrow with generous ascenders and descenders, while the lowercase stays comparatively small, creating a high-contrast in proportions between capitals and the main text line. The forms favor open curves and occasional loops, with simple crossbars and understated joins that keep the texture light and spacious. Numerals follow the same handwritten cadence, maintaining the narrow footprint and flowing stroke movement.

Well-suited for invitations, greeting cards, and wedding or event stationery where an elegant handwritten voice is desired. It can also work for boutique branding, packaging accents, pull quotes, and social posts—especially as headlines, names, or short phrases where the tall, narrow forms have room to breathe.

The overall tone feels graceful and personal—more like a quick, stylish handwritten note than a formal calligraphic script. Its lightness and narrowness give it an airy sophistication, while the fluid motion keeps it friendly and informal.

The design appears intended to capture a modern signature-script feel: quick, fluid penmanship with refined proportions and a light touch. It prioritizes stylish movement and an airy page color over dense text texture, making it most effective for display-oriented applications.

Uppercase characters read as expressive, signature-like initials with prominent swashes and elongated strokes, which can add sparkle but also create a lively, uneven word silhouette at larger sizes. Stroke weight is consistently fine, so the design reads best when given enough size and contrast against the background.
